About the Book

Trey Blake is on a hunting trip in his own backyard. That is, the three million acre designated Wilderness area that borders the Dagger Ranch deeded land. You can get lost out there and never be found. Families have waited years for news of relatives lost in this Wilderness. One such event was the loss of a private airplane owned by the Ranch's absentee owners. Now, weather, erosion, and decay of downed timber combines to reveal the crash site. Trey finds it. It is hard to know how a story gets it's start but the plane has long been rumored to carry Drug Cartel money and lots of it. Trey knows the rumor as well as anyone and he is alone out there with "nobody to ask permission from and nobody to deny it." He is going into that plane to find out for himself. This is the story of the few that know big country and big cow outfits best. The Dagger runs several thousand head of cattle, grazing on four-hundred thousand acres of land. These men are horseman first, cowhands second, hunters seasonally and loyal friends to a fault. With the ranch being sold and broken up for development the certain prospect of un-employment and re-location stares them in the face. Maybe it's time for even an honest Cowhand to take a chance on the Devil's luck and roll the dice. Are you lucky, are you ready for your destiny. Most men have never been either. Many men face a ride off into the sunset because it's their only way home. But there is a time in every man's life when he has an opportunity to cross his own personal "Rubicon." If you know you are ready you should never hesitate, once you start you can't go back, and when you are challenged, and you will be, you can't back down. One thing though, when a Cowboy fancies to take his chances, chances will be taken.
About the Author: The Author has spent much of his life horseback in big country. He has held an Outfitter's/Guides License in Wyoming and New Mexico for many years. He has Cowboyed from Texas to Montana. He lived the life he writes about and brings an authentic voice to his stories.
